Hey plugin folks — quick handover on the stale-cache bug in Glimmerkit. Turns out the manifest cache wasn't invalidating after plugin reloads, so old hooks kept firing. Fix shipped in the nightly; full postmortem is on the Driftwood wiki. If your plugin still sees stale data, flag it. The postmortem owner is listed below.

account owner for bawip-tahag: Raleth Quenok

Hey — handing off the Murkwell metrics sidecar before I head out. It aggregates counters from every pod on the Stavrel cluster and flushes every 30s. Known quirk: if the flush backs up, restart the sidecar, not the main container, or you'll drop a scrape window. Dashboards are under the Murkwell folder. If the sidecar's config store gets wedged, you'll need to unseal it manually with the recovery passphrase, which is right here.

strongbox words: fraath-isteth

## Changelog — Tidemark Widget 3.2

Defaults changed. Read before touching anything.

- Refresh interval now hourly, not every 15 min. Harbor feeds from the Pellisport aggregator throttle aggressive polling.
- Lunar-offset correction is on by default. Disable only for legacy Kestrel Bay deployments.
- Chart units default to metric. The imperial fallback flag is deprecated and will be removed in 3.4.
- Cache eviction is now time-based, not size-based.

New installs should start from the default configuration values listed below.

config for kahap-taweg:
oliox:
  pin: 8609
  tenant: casath
  seal: seal_632a4a6f
  metrics_host: metrics.oliox.nelvrogrid.example
  standby_team: keleth
  escalation: briiel-oliwyn
  nonce: e2397c